Author’s Note---Another ‘Dime Novel’ story. This was written from notes found in the archives of Edward Wheeler, a ‘Dime Novel’ writer. He had interviewed a man who called himself Brushy Bill Roberts and claimed to be the infamous Billy the Kid. This ‘Brushy Bill’ told him a story about Pat Garrett and Pat’s wife Juanita. The tale was so ‘strange’ that Wheeler never wrote the story. The following is what was in the notes taken at that interview long ago in a café in Del Rio, Texas. No way to know if there is a word of truth in it. What we do know is that Wheeler never published the story.
The Book Cover, according to Wheeler’s notes, was going to show Pat Garrett and his wife walking down a wooden walkway in a frontier town. Pat is dressed in nice clothes for the time, 1879. You can see his pistol and his Sheriff’s badge. His wife, a beautiful, young Mexican lady, is dressed in a long white dress. She is carrying a parasol to keep the hot noonday sun off her as she looks across the street at a young cowboy, Billy the Kid, staring back at her.
